TVS Brings the iQube Electric Scooter to Kenya, a First for an Indian Maker in Africa
PHOTOEVFY↗ View original

India's TVS Motor has launched its iQube electric scooter in Kenya, becoming the first Indian OEM to bring a premium electric scooter to Africa. The top iQube 3.5 variant covers 115km on a full charge, while the entry iQube 2.2 is priced at 338,000 Kenyan shillings and sold through longtime local partner Car & General.
